This book focuses on practical classroom ideas in mathematical modelling suitable to be used by mathematics teachers at the secondary level. It provides everything that teachers and mathematics educators need to design and implement mathematical modelling activities in their classroom.

About the author

Ang Keng Cheng is an Associate Professor of Mathematics and Mathematics Education, and the Associate Dean for Higher Degrees at the National Institute of Education, Nanyang Technological University, Singapore.
